当前位置: 首页 > news >正文

苏州建网站必去苏州聚尚网络公司做网站 分录

苏州建网站必去苏州聚尚网络,公司做网站 分录,企业办公软件排名,网站域名销售很久之前用过flask#xff0c;那时候是跟着教程#xff0c;教程怎么做我就怎么做#xff0c;没有仔细考虑过。 现在是全靠文档和搜索一步一步搭建#xff0c;忘了很多东西#xff0c;就碰了很多壁#xff0c;浅浅记录一下子。 1.Jinja2的模板继承#xff0c;是指抽出每…很久之前用过flask那时候是跟着教程教程怎么做我就怎么做没有仔细考虑过。 现在是全靠文档和搜索一步一步搭建忘了很多东西就碰了很多壁浅浅记录一下子。 1.Jinja2的模板继承是指抽出每个网页相同的部分作为base然后以base为底在此基础上进行不同页面的展示。 比如我一个网页设置了导航栏和背景其他页面都是以此为基础显示不同内容但是我又不想都写在同一个网页上显得杂乱故此分离开来应该是这样使用 base.html !DOCTYPE html html langen headmeta charsetUTF-8meta nameviewport contentwidthdevice-width, initial-scale1titlemyWeb/titlelink relstylesheet typetext/css href../static/css/base.csslink relstylesheet typetext/css href../static/css/bootstrap.cssscript src../static/js/jquery.min.js/scriptscript typetext/javascript src../static/js/daterangepicker.js/scriptscript typetext/javascript src../static/js/bootstrap.bundle.js/script {% block head %}{% endblock %} /head body nav classnavbar navbar-expand-lg bg-body-tertiarydiv classcontainer-fluida classnavbar-brand href#Navbar/abutton classnavbar-toggler typebutton data-bs-togglecollapse data-bs-target#navbarNav aria-controlsnavbarNav aria-expandedfalse aria-labelToggle navigationspan classnavbar-toggler-icon/span/buttondiv classcollapse navbar-collapse idnavbarNavul classnavbar-nav idmyTabli classnav-itema classnav-link active aria-currentpage href/Home/a/lili classnav-itema classnav-link href/page1page1/a/lili classnav-itema classnav-link href/page2page2/a/lili classnav-itema classnav-link href/page3page3/a/li/ul/div/div /nav {% block content %}{% endblock %} /body script $(document).ready(function () {$(#myTab).find(li).each(function () {var a $(this).find(a:first)[0];console.log(location.pathname)if ($(a).attr(href) location.pathname) {$(a).addClass(active);} else {$(a).removeClass(active);}}); }); /script /html 可以注意到在这里我设置了两个代码块的区域分别是block head和block content这两个地方就是用于其他页面进行继承的如果要引入只在子页面会用到的js之类可以在block head里面添加而页面主体显示部分则是在block content里面当然我看别人的还把title也用block包裹方便子页面改名我的业务没有相关需求就没改。 home.html {% extends base.html %}{% block content%} pthis is home page/p {% endblock %} page1.html {% extends base.html %}{% block content%} pthis is page1/p {% endblock %} 其他的以此类推这样就不需要重新写一次导航栏也能把不同页面分在不同的HTML文件当中了。 我之前踩的坑主要在于以为不同页面就要继承不同的代码块在base定义了很多比如block home, block page1, block page2这种然后再继承后来发现显示出问题了才醒悟过来既然显示的地方都一样就没必要新建那么多都是替换同一块区域就行了
http://www.hkea.cn/news/14445957/

相关文章:

  • 手机页面网站模板怎么卖江门网站建设哪家快
  • xunsearch做搜索网站搜索案例的网站有哪些
  • 自主建站seo优化策略主要包括哪些方面
  • 哈尔滨模版建站公司推荐网站续费话术
  • 网站开发运行环境论文网站多语言模块
  • 阿里巴巴吧国际网站怎么做花卉网站建设策划
  • 免费软件下载网站哪个好商务网站建设毕业设计模板
  • 2021网站建设前景怎么样网站建设交流会
  • 电商平台网站建设方案建设金融行业网站
  • asp.net个人网站空间高网站排名吗
  • 盐步网站制作专注网站制作
  • 网站开发后台短视频动画人物说话制作
  • 广州品牌网站学网站建设软件开发
  • 为什么打开网站是建设中店铺推广平台有哪些
  • 如何制作公司网站友情链接2598
  • 爬取数据做网站网站域名查询网址
  • 心理健康网站建设论文怎么看网站谁做的
  • 临沂河东区建设局网站图片无法显示wordpress
  • 班级网站 php白山市网站建设
  • 国外虚拟物品交易网站杭州软件建设
  • 上杭县铁路建设办公室网站途牛旅行网网站建设
  • 做游戏音频下载网站html简单百度网页代码
  • 九江商城网站建设2008系统怎么搭建多个网站
  • 网站建设需求建议书常州网站建设方案托管
  • 做网站开发钱电子商务运营实务中网站开发流程
  • 网站建设公司排wordpress优惠码
  • 深圳网站建设世纪前线360建筑网怎么样
  • 建设装饰网站建设网站交流
  • 网站打开是别人的辽宁省建设工程信息网官网查询
  • 有哪些教育网站做的比较好seo怎么优化步骤